Output 74292b04ddbf99824f7d5920ee5ddc6ae3e30f9d9b21b2dfb67e1bd92fcbdd3d:0

value
6965208022970
script pubkey
OP_0 OP_PUSHBYTES_20 e3a4bbf1c9b0c841c3c39756233a73e87653382e
address
tb1quwjthuwfkryyrs7rjatzxwnnapm9xwpw2meks2
transaction
74292b04ddbf99824f7d5920ee5ddc6ae3e30f9d9b21b2dfb67e1bd92fcbdd3d
confirmations
139342
spent
true